Abstract

The optimum condition of extracting total flavones from bamboo leaf by ultrasound wave was studied in this paper.Based on single factor test,the orthogonal experiments were conducted with 4 factors of ethanol solutions,the ratio of raw materials to solvent,ultrasonic power and extraction time.Under the conditions of 65% ethanol solutions,the ratio of ethanol to material 20:1(W/V),ultrasonic power 500W,extraction time 10min,treating with ultrasonic for twice repeatedly at the temperature of 50℃,the extraction efficiency of the total flavones was the best.
